Ситуации, когда сотрудник вынужден изменить даты своего отдыха в последний момент, возникают в каждой организации достаточно часто. Это может быть связано с производственной необходимостью, болезнью работника или его личным желанием. В таких случаях перед кадровиком или бухгалтером встает задача корректно отразить эти изменения в учетной системе 1С:Зарплата и управление персоналом или 1С:Бухгалтерия предприятия. Ошибки на этом этапе могут привести к неверному начислению отпускных, проблемам с табелем учета рабочего времени и искажению остатков дней отпуска.

Процедура переноса не сводится к простой правке одного документа, так как система 1С жестко привязывает начисления к периодам и основанию. Важно понимать, что технически «перенести» уже утвержденный приказ одной кнопкой невозможно. Вам потребуется последовательно отменить старый период и зарегистрировать новый, соблюдая логику кадрового документооборота. Ниже мы разберем алгоритм действий для актуальных версий конфигураций на платформе 1С 8.3.

Прежде чем приступить к работе в программе, убедитесь, что у вас на руках есть все необходимые justificatory документы от сотрудника. Обычно это заявление о переносе отпуска и новый приказ руководителя. Без бумажного основания вносить изменения в информационную базу рискованно, так как это может вызвать вопросы при аудиторской проверке или налоговом контроле.

Подготовка документов и анализ текущей ситуации

Первым шагом является анализ того, в каком статусе находится текущий отпуск в базе данных. Если приказ уже проведен, но отпускные еще не выплачены, процедура упрощается. Однако если деньги уже перечислены сотруднику, возникает необходимость сторнирования или перерасчета, что требует особого внимания. Вам нужно четко определить, переносится ли отпуск полностью или его часть присоединяется к другому периоду.

В системе 1С ключевым объектом, хранящим информацию о планах отдыха, является документ Отпуска (плановые графики). Именно здесь фиксируются утвержденные даты до издания приказа. Если изменения происходят на этапе планирования, достаточно внести правки в этот документ. Если же приказ уже издан, ситуация усложняется.

Необходимо проверить, не был ли уже сформирован и проведен документ Начисление отпускных. Наличие этого документа блокирует возможность простого редактирования дат в приказе. В таких случаях система потребует от вас сначала отменить финансовые начисления, чтобы освободить период для новых расчетов.

⚠️ Внимание: Никогда не пытайтесь изменить даты отпуска в уже проведенном документе «Приказ на отпуск» задним числом, если по нему уже сформированы проводки или выплачены деньги. Это приведет к рассинхронизации данных в регистрах накопления и ошибкам в отчете Т-13.

💡

Перед началом работы сделайте резервную копию базы данных или выгрузите документ «Приказ на отпуск» в отдельный файл через обработку выгрузки данных, чтобы иметь возможность быстро откатить изменения в случае ошибки.

Отмена ранее созданного приказа на отпуск

Для корректного переноса дат первым делом нужно аннулировать действие старого приказа. В интерфейсе 1С это делается не через удаление документа, а через механизм проведения с обратным знаком или создание документа-отмены, в зависимости от версии конфигурации. В большинстве современных релизов ЗУП 3.1 используется метод сторнирования.

Найдите в журнале документов «Приказы по личному составу» нужный документ. Откройте его и проверьте статус проведения. Если документ проведен, вам необходимо снять его с проведения. Для этого нажмите кнопку Отмена проведения в верхней панели или используйте сочетание клавиш, предназначенное для этой операции в вашей версии платформы.

После отмены проведения система автоматически сделает сторнировочные записи в регистрах. Это означает, что дни отпуска перестанут считаться использованными, а начисленные ранее суммы (если они были) будут обнулены в текущем месяце. Важно убедиться, что в результате этих действий у сотрудника восстановился баланс дней отпуска, который был списан ранее.

  • 📄 Найдите исходный приказ в журнале регистрации.
  • 🚫 Снимите документ с проведения для аннулирования записей.
  • 💰 Проверьте, что начисления отпускных обнулились в регистре расчетов.
  • 📅 Убедитесь, что период отпуска исчез из графика отсутствий.

Если в вашей организации используется сложный документооборот с визированием, убедитесь, что отмена приказа также согласована с руководителем. В 1С можно оставить комментарий в поле «Комментарий» документа, указав причину отмены, например: «Перенос по заявлению сотрудника от 15.05.2026».

☑️ Контроль отмены приказа

Выполнено: 0 / 4

Создание нового приказа с актуальными датами

После того как старый период «освобожден», можно приступать к оформлению нового отпуска. Создайте новый документ Приказ на отпуск (или «Отпуск», в зависимости от терминологии вашей конфигурации). В шапке документа укажите актуальную дату издания приказа, которая соответствует текущему моменту или дате подписания руководителем нового распоряжения.

В табличной части документа выберите сотрудника и укажите новые даты начала и окончания отдыха. Система автоматически пересчитает количество календарных дней. Обратите внимание на поле Вид отпуска: оно должно совпадать с первоначальным (например, «Ежегодный основной»), если только сотрудник не решил заменить часть отпуска на денежную компенсацию, что требует отдельной процедуры.

Особое внимание уделите полю «Основание». Здесь необходимо сослаться на новое заявление сотрудника. В 1С можно прикрепить скан заявления прямо к документу, используя кнопку «Присоединить файл». Это упростит работу аудиторов в будущем, так как вся первичная документация будет собрана в одном месте.

Путь к документу: Зарплата и кадры – Все начисления – Приказы на отпуск – Создать

При проведении нового документа система снова спишет дни с баланса сотрудника и сформирует запись в графике отпусков. Если вы используете функционал плановых графиков, не забудьте также обновить документ Отпуска (плановые графики), чтобы данные о фактическом отдыхе совпадали с плановыми на следующий год.

⚠️ Внимание: Если перенос отпуска происходит в рамках одного расчетного периода (месяца), убедитесь, что новый документ проведен той же датой, что и старый, либо датой фактического подписания нового приказа, чтобы не сбить период закрытия месяца.

Что делать, если даты пересекаются с больничным?

Если новый период отпуска частично или полностью совпадает с периодом временной нетрудоспособности, система 1С при расчете может выдать предупреждение. В этом случае дни отпуска, совпадающие с больничным, не оплачиваются, а отпуск продлевается или переносится на количество дней нетрудоспособности. Это требует оформления еще одного приказа на перенос оставшихся дней.

Расчет и выплата отпускных при переносе

Финансовая часть переноса отпуска является наиболее критичной. Если отпускные по старому приказу еще не были выплачены, то после отмены проведения старого документа и создания нового, вам достаточно просто провести документ Начисление отпускных заново. Система рассчитает сумму исходя из новых дат и актуального среднего заработка.

В случае, когда деньги уже перечислены сотруднику на карту или выданы из кассы, возникает кассовый разрыв или переплата. Здесь алгоритм действий зависит от суммы. Если новый расчет показывает сумму меньше выплаченной, образуется переплата, которую можно удержать из следующей зарплаты (с соблюдением ограничений ТК РФ — не более 20%). Если сумма больше — необходимо начислить разницу.

Для отражения этих операций в 1С используется документ Начисление зарплаты и взносов или специализированный документ Корректировка регистрации в бухгалтерском учете, если требуется ручное вмешательство. Автоматический пересчет при создании нового приказа на отпуск обычно создает документ начисления с положительной или отрицательной суммой.

Ситуация Действие в 1С Финансовый результат
Отпускные не выплачены Отменить старый, создать новый приказ Выплата новой рассчитанной суммы
Выплачено больше, чем нужно Сторнирование начисления, зачет в счет будущей ЗП Образование дебиторской задолженности сотрудника
Выплачено меньше, чем нужно Доначисление разницы новым документом Доплата сотруднику в ближайшую выплату
Перенос на следующий месяц Корректировка периода начисления Отражение в расходах следующего месяца

Важно контролировать, чтобы в ведомости на выплату зарплаты не попали «лишние» начисления. При формировании ведомости проверьте состав начислений, исключив дублирующиеся записи, если система не сделала это автоматически.

📊 Как вы обычно решаете проблему переплаты отпускных?
Удерживаем из следующей зарплаты
Просим сотрудника вернуть деньги в кассу
Оставляем как аванс
Прощаем долг сотруднику

Корректировка табеля учета рабочего времени

После изменения дат отпуска необходимо убедиться, что эти изменения корректно отразились в табеле учета рабочего времени (форма Т-13). В 1С табель формируется автоматически на основании документов-оснований, таких как приказы на отпуск, больничные и явки. Однако иногда требуется ручная проверка, особенно если перенос произошел в середине уже закрытого месяца.

Откройте документ Табель учета рабочего времени за соответствующий месяц. Проверьте ячейки, соответствующие датам старого и нового отпуска. Коды обозначений должны быть изменены: вместо дней работы (Я) в дни нового отпуска должен стоять код ОТ (ежегодный основной оплачиваемый отпуск). Дни, которые ранее считались отпуском, а теперь стали рабочими, должны быть отмечены кодом Я.

Если табель уже был утвержден или передан в бухгалтерию для расчета зарплаты, внесение изменений потребует создания нового экземпляра табеля или использования механизма корректировки. В некоторых версиях 1С при изменении приказа табель обновляется автоматически при нажатии кнопки Заполнить. В других случаях может потребоваться ручное исправление явок.

  • 📅 Откройте табель за месяц переноса.
  • 🔄 Нажмите кнопку «Заполнить» для обновления данных из приказов.
  • 👀 Визуально проверьте коды явок в измененном периоде.
  • ✅ Убедитесь, что количество часов отпуска совпадает с новым приказом.

Не забудьте, что неправильный код в табеле может привести к ошибкам при расчете стажа для предоставления следующего отпуска. Система анализирует коды явок для определения права на отпуск в будущем.

💡

Автоматическое обновление табеля происходит только при своевременном проведении приказов до момента окончательного расчета зарплаты за месяц. Если месяц закрыт, требуется перерасчет.

Частые ошибки и способы их устранения

При переносе отпусков пользователи 1С часто сталкиваются с типовыми проблемами. Одна из самых распространенных — ошибка «Период пересекается с другим отсутствием». Это возникает, если новый отпуск накладывается на уже существующий в базе больничный, другой отпуск или отгул. Система блокирует проведение, чтобы избежать двойной оплаты одного и того же времени.

Для решения этой проблемы необходимо сначала найти и временно отменить проведения всех пересекающихся документов. После создания и проведения нового приказа на отпуск, документы-конфликтеры (например, больничный) нужно провести заново. 1С автоматически скорректирует начисления, учитывая приоритет видов оплат.

Еще одна частая ошибка связана с неверным указанием периода работы для расчета среднего заработка. При переносе отпуска на следующий расчетный год база для расчета может измениться. Всегда проверяйте вкладку «Главное» в документе начисления отпускных, чтобы убедиться, что алгоритм расчета подхватил правильные месяцы.

⚠️ Внимание: Интерфейс и названия пунктов меню могут незначительно отличаться в зависимости от версии конфигурации (ЗУП 3.0, ЗУП 3.1, Бухгалтерия 3.0) и обновления платформы 1С. Всегда сверяйтесь с официальными формами документов, если сомневаетесь в корректности заполнения полей.

Если вы столкнулись с ситуацией, когда система не позволяет отменить проведение приказа из-за зависимых документов (например, уже сформована отчетность), воспользуйтесь обработкой Групповое перепроведение документов или обратитесь к администратору базы для анализа блокировок.

💡

Используйте отчет «Анализ состояния расчета зарплаты» перед началом массовых переносов отпусков. Он покажет потенциальные конфликты и ошибки в данных сотрудников, которые могут помешать корректному пересчету.

Можно ли перенести отпуск задним числом в 1С?

Технически можно провести документ датой в прошлом, но это нарушает хронологию документооборота. Если месяц уже закрыт и по нему сдана отчетность, внесение изменений задним числом потребует пересчета налогов и взносов, а также сдачи уточненных расчетов (РСВ, 6-НДФЛ). Делайте это только в крайних случаях и с согласования главного бухгалтера.

Что делать, если сотрудник уже отгулял часть отпуска до переноса?

В этом случае нельзя просто отменить весь приказ. Необходимо оформить отзыв из отпуска на неиспользованную часть или оформить перенос только оставшихся дней. В 1С это делается через создание нового приказа на оставшуюся часть дней с указанием корректных дат, при этом дни, которые сотрудник уже отгулял, остаются в прошлом периоде как использованные.

Как перенос отпуска влияет на НДФЛ и страховые взносы?

Дата удержания НДФЛ привязана к дате фактической выплаты отпускных. При переносе отпуска и перерасчете сумм может измениться дата возникновения налогового обязательства. Если перенос меняет месяц выплаты, НДФЛ нужно отразить в том месяце, когда деньги фактически поступили сотруднику (или будут удержаны из зарплаты при зачете переплаты).

Нужно ли печатать новый приказ, если даты изменились на 1 день?

Да, любое изменение дат отпуска требует документального оформления. Старый приказ аннулируется, и издается новый приказ с актуальными датами. В 1С это отражается созданием нового документа «Приказ на отпуск». Печатная форма Т-6 также должна быть сформирована заново и подписана руководителем и сотрудником.

Может ли 1С автоматически предложить перенос при наложении на больничный?

В современных версиях ЗУП 3.1 есть функционал, который предупреждает о наложении периодов, но автоматический перенос дат отпуска при вводе больничного обычно не производится. Пользователь должен самостоятельно принять решение о продлении или переносе и оформить соответствующий приказ вручную в системе.